Title

Fleet Conversion Plan and Community-Wide EV Charging Plan Update

Body

The Los Alamos County Fleet Conversion Plan and Community-Wide EV Charging Plan is a Los Alamos County Council initiative led by Stantec in collaboration with County staff. This project kicked off in March 2025. Stantec will provide a comprehensive overview on the progress made since our initial meeting. The Los Alamos Fleet Conversion and Community-Wide EV Charging Plan builds on the County’s Climate Action Plan goals to reduce greenhouse gas emissions 30% by 2030, 80% by 2040, and achieve carbon neutrality by 2050. This project evaluates the County’s fleet operations and community-wide charging network to identify opportunities for electrification, cost savings, and improved sustainability. The plan includes a roadmap for transitioning County vehicles to zero-emission technologies, strategies for siting and scaling EV charging infrastructure, and considerations for power needs and funding opportunities. The project team hosted a public meeting in May 2025 and community survey this past summer to gather input on priorities and potential charging locations. This presentation shares the results of the project’s analysis, including a coordinated strategy to advance both municipal and public EV readiness in Los Alamos County.
